#7db368 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7db368 is composed of 49% red, 70.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 103.2 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 55.5%. #7db368 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ffd0 with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7db368 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7db368 has RGB values of R:125, G:179,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 8237928.

Shades and Tints of #7db368
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040603 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7db368
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c908b is the less saturated color, while #5ef922 is the most saturated one.
